About Charles Lenox Remond

  • Charles Lenox Remond (February 1, 1810 – December 22, 1873) was an American orator, activist and abolitionist based in Massachusetts.
  • He lectured against slavery across the Northeast, and in the British Isles on an 1840 tour with William Lloyd Garrison.
  • During the American Civil War, he recruited blacks for the United States Colored Troops, helping staff the first two units sent from Massachusetts.
  • From a large family of African-American entrepreneurs, he was the brother of Sarah Parker Remond, also a lecturer against slavery.
